By   Vadym ChutchevCMO
Published:  June 14, 2024

In today's digital era, businesses are increasingly relying on mobile applications to engage with their customers, streamline their operations, and boost their overall productivity. The proliferation of smartphones, particularly those powered by Android, has led to an unprecedented demand for mobile apps. This trend has sparked a debate among business owners and decision-makers: Is custom Android app development worth the investment?


To explore this question comprehensively, we need to delve into the various facets of custom Android app development, its benefits, potential drawbacks, and the scenarios in which it can be a game-changer for businesses. This article will provide an in-depth analysis to help you determine whether partnering with a custom Android app development company or investing in custom mobile application development services is the right move for your business.


Understanding Custom Android App Development


Custom Android app development refers to the process of designing and building mobile applications tailored to meet the specific needs and requirements of a business or organization. Unlike off-the-shelf apps, which are generic solutions designed for a broad audience, custom apps are bespoke solutions that address unique challenges and leverage specific opportunities.


A custom mobile application development company works closely with clients to understand their business objectives, target audience, and operational needs. Based on this understanding, the company develops an app that aligns with the client's goals and provides a seamless user experience. Custom app developers utilize their expertise to create applications that are not only functional but also intuitive and engaging.


Benefits of Custom Android App Development


 1. Tailored to Specific Needs


One of the most significant advantages of custom Android app development is that the app is tailored to the specific needs of your business. Whether you need a feature-rich e-commerce platform, a sophisticated enterprise app, or a user-friendly customer service tool, a custom mobile application development company can create a solution that fits your exact requirements. This level of customization ensures that the app supports your business processes and helps you achieve your strategic goals.


 2. Enhanced User Experience


Custom mobile app development prioritizes the user experience UX). Custom apps are designed with the end-users in mind, ensuring that the interface is intuitive, the navigation is smooth, and the overall user journey is enjoyable. By providing a superior UX, you can increase user engagement, satisfaction, and retention, which are crucial for the app's success.


 3. Scalability and Flexibility


A custom Android app can be designed to scale with your business. As your business grows, your app can be updated with new features and functionalities to accommodate the changing needs of your users. This flexibility is particularly important for businesses that anticipate significant growth or changes in their operations. Off-the-shelf solutions, on the other hand, often lack this level of adaptability.


 4. Competitive Advantage


In a crowded marketplace, having a unique, custom app can set you apart from your competitors. A custom app can offer features and capabilities that are not available in generic solutions, giving your business a distinct edge. By providing a unique value proposition to your customers, you can differentiate your brand and enhance your competitive position.


 5. Integration with Existing Systems


Custom Android apps can be seamlessly integrated with your existing systems and software. Whether you need to connect your app with your CRM, ERP, or other enterprise systems, a custom app development company can ensure that all your systems work together harmoniously. This integration enhances operational efficiency and ensures a smooth flow of information across your organization.


 6. Improved Security


Security is a paramount concern for any business, especially when dealing with sensitive data. Custom mobile app development services prioritize security, implementing robust measures to protect your data and ensure compliance with relevant regulations. By controlling the security features of your app, you can mitigate risks and safeguard your business and customer information.


Potential Drawbacks of Custom Android App Development


While the benefits of custom Android app development are compelling, it is essential to consider the potential drawbacks to make an informed decision.


 1. Higher Initial Costs


Developing a custom app requires a significant investment of time and resources. The costs associated with hiring a custom mobile application development company, conducting thorough research, and building a bespoke solution can be higher than opting for an off-the-shelf app. However, this initial investment can be justified by the long-term benefits and return on investment ROI) that a custom app can deliver.


 2. Longer Development Time


Creating a custom Android app is a complex process that involves multiple stages, including requirement analysis, design, development, testing, and deployment. This process can take several months, depending on the complexity of the app and the specific requirements of your business. If you need a quick solution, an off-the-shelf app might be more suitable. However, for long-term strategic initiatives, the time invested in custom app development can be worthwhile.


 3. Maintenance and Updates


A custom app requires ongoing maintenance and updates to ensure it remains functional, secure, and relevant. This maintenance can involve additional costs and resources. However, working with a reliable custom mobile app development company can streamline this process and ensure that your app continues to meet your business needs.


Scenarios Where Custom Android App Development is Worth the Investment


To determine whether custom Android app development is worth the investment for your business, consider the following scenarios:


 1. Unique Business Requirements


If your business has unique requirements that cannot be addressed by generic solutions, a custom app is the way to go. For example, if you operate in a niche market or have specific operational processes that need to be supported by your app, a custom mobile application development company can create a solution tailored to your needs.


 2. Focus on Customer Experience


If providing an exceptional customer experience is a priority for your business, investing in custom app development is essential. A custom app allows you to design a user experience that aligns with your brand and meets the expectations of your target audience.


 3. Long-Term Strategic Goals


For businesses with long-term strategic goals, such as expanding into new markets or launching innovative services, a custom Android app can provide the necessary support and flexibility. Custom mobile app development services can create scalable solutions that grow with your business and adapt to changing market conditions.


 4. Integration with Existing Systems


If your business relies on multiple systems and software, a custom app can ensure seamless integration and enhance operational efficiency. Custom app developers can create an app that works harmoniously with your existing infrastructure, eliminating data silos and streamlining workflows.


 5. Enhanced Security Requirements


For businesses that handle sensitive data, such as financial services, healthcare, or e-commerce, security is a top priority. Custom Android app development services can implement advanced security measures tailored to your specific needs, ensuring compliance and protecting your data.


Choosing the Right Custom Android App Development Company


Choosing the right custom mobile app development company is crucial to the success of your app. Here are some factors to consider when making your decision:


 1. Expertise and Experience


Look for a company with a proven track record in custom Android app development. Review their portfolio to see examples of their work and assess their expertise in developing apps similar to what you need.


 2. Client Reviews and Testimonials


Client reviews and testimonials provide valuable insights into the company's reliability, quality of work, and customer service. Look for reviews on independent platforms to get an unbiased perspective.


 3. Technical Skills and Innovation


Ensure that the company has a team of skilled developers who are proficient in the latest technologies and trends in mobile app development. Their ability to innovate and stay ahead of the curve will be crucial for the success of your app.


 4. Communication and Collaboration


Effective communication and collaboration are essential for a successful development process. Choose a company that values transparency, keeps you informed about the progress, and is open to your feedback and suggestions.


 5. Post-Development Support


A reliable custom mobile app development company should offer post-development support, including maintenance, updates, and troubleshooting. This support ensures that your app remains functional and up-to-date.


Investing in custom Android app development can be a strategic move for businesses looking to differentiate themselves, enhance user experience, and achieve their long-term goals. While the initial costs and development time may be higher compared to off-the-shelf solutions, the benefits of a tailored, scalable, and secure app can far outweigh these drawbacks.


By partnering with a reputable custom mobile application development company, you can create a solution that aligns with your business objectives, integrates seamlessly with your existing systems, and provides a competitive edge in the marketplace. Whether you need to address unique business requirements, prioritize customer experience, or ensure robust security, custom Android app development services can deliver a solution that meets your needs and drives your business forward.


In conclusion, custom Android app development is worth the investment for businesses that value customization, scalability, and a superior user experience. By carefully selecting the right custom app development company and leveraging their expertise, you can create an app that not only meets your immediate needs but also supports your long-term strategic vision.

